AvogadroLibs 1.101.0
Loading...
Searching...
No Matches
EnergyCalculator Member List

This is the complete list of members for EnergyCalculator, including all inherited members.

acceptsIons() constEnergyCalculatorvirtual
acceptsRadicals() constEnergyCalculatorvirtual
acceptsUnitCell() constEnergyCalculatorvirtual
appendError(const std::string &errorString, bool newLine=true) constEnergyCalculatorprotected
cleanGradients(TVector &grad)EnergyCalculator
constraintEnergies(const TVector &x)EnergyCalculator
constraintGradients(const TVector &x, TVector &grad)EnergyCalculator
constraints() constEnergyCalculator
description() const =0EnergyCalculatorpure virtual
elements() const =0EnergyCalculatorpure virtual
EnergyCalculator()=default (defined in EnergyCalculator)EnergyCalculator
gradient(const TVector &x, TVector &grad) overrideEnergyCalculator
identifier() const =0EnergyCalculatorpure virtual
m_angleConstraints (defined in EnergyCalculator)EnergyCalculatorprotected
m_distanceConstraints (defined in EnergyCalculator)EnergyCalculatorprotected
m_mask (defined in EnergyCalculator)EnergyCalculatorprotected
m_outOfPlaneConstraints (defined in EnergyCalculator)EnergyCalculatorprotected
m_torsionConstraints (defined in EnergyCalculator)EnergyCalculatorprotected
mask() constEnergyCalculator
name() const =0EnergyCalculatorpure virtual
newInstance() const =0EnergyCalculatorpure virtual
setConfiguration(Core::VariantMap &config)EnergyCalculatorvirtual
setConstraints(const std::vector< Core::Constraint > &constraints) (defined in EnergyCalculator)EnergyCalculator
setMask(TVector mask)EnergyCalculator
setMolecule(Core::Molecule *mol)=0EnergyCalculatorpure virtual
~EnergyCalculator() override=default (defined in EnergyCalculator)EnergyCalculator